It has been open to the public since late last year, but not many know about Al Jurf Gardens in Abu Dhabi. The National set out to visit the nature reserve-turned-picnic spot and came away entranced.
Located on the coast in between and less than an hour's drive from the cities of Abu Dhabi and Dubai, the project by Imkan Properties is a residential community with a countryside feel reminiscent of Enid Blyton's Enchanted Wood.
Originally created to protect the deer and antelope that are native to the UAE, the reserve also affords visitors the chance to spot various species of gazelle and oryx, as well as other wildlife and birds. At the end of the dirt path is a cutesy cafe called Dialogue, which overlooks the sparkling waters of the Arabian Gulf.
Shaded by a canopy of trees, families can be spotted picnicking on the sand. It is a seamless way to connect with nature and feels miles away from the hubbub of city life.
Near and deer
If you are driving through the area without stopping, at first glance the dirt road seems to be surrounded only by trees and the odd bird, but look carefully and it is likely you will spot a grazing herd of deer.
They scare easily, though, so be mindful of their privacy. If you want to take pictures, roll down the car windows rather than walking up to their retreating backs.
Approximately halfway between the entrance and the cafe is a custom-built feeding area, with water and food laid out for the animals. Waiting here is your best chance to spot them but, again, be careful not to scare them away.
Best time to go
Make your way over in the morning or afternoon, especially if you want to see deer, as the tree canopy means there is not a lot of light – even in the daytime.
If you want to go off the dirt road into the soft sand arenas, or all the way to the seaside, a 4x4 is recommended, although sedans are perfectly fine on the dirt road.
Where is Al Jurf?
Al Jurf is located at 24.8536351, 54.8005832. Take the Al Samha exit and turn towards the Nature Reserves sign at the roundabout.

Why your domicile status is important
Your UK residence status is assessed using the statutory residence test. While your residence status – ie where you live - is assessed every year, your domicile status is assessed over your lifetime.
Your domicile of origin generally comes from your parents and if your parents were not married, then it is decided by your father. Your domicile is generally the country your father considered his permanent home when you were born.
UK residents who have their permanent home ("domicile") outside the UK may not have to pay UK tax on foreign income. For example, they do not pay tax on foreign income or gains if they are less than £2,000 in the tax year and do not transfer that gain to a UK bank account.
A UK-domiciled person, however, is liable for UK tax on their worldwide income and gains when they are resident in the UK.

Know your Camel lingo
The bairaq is a competition for the best herd of 50 camels, named for the banner its winner takes home
Namoos - a word of congratulations reserved for falconry competitions, camel races and camel pageants. It best translates as 'the pride of victory' - and for competitors, it is priceless
Asayel camels - sleek, short-haired hound-like racers
Majahim - chocolate-brown camels that can grow to weigh two tonnes. They were only valued for milk until camel pageantry took off in the 1990s
Millions Street - the thoroughfare where camels are led and where white 4x4s throng throughout the festival

History's medical milestones
1799 - First small pox vaccine administered
1846 - First public demonstration of anaesthesia in surgery
1861 - Louis Pasteur published his germ theory which proved that bacteria caused diseases
1895 - Discovery of x-rays
1923 - Heart valve surgery performed successfully for first time
1928 - Alexander Fleming discovers penicillin
1953 - Structure of DNA discovered
1952 - First organ transplant - a kidney - takes place
1954 - Clinical trials of birth control pill
1979 - MRI, or magnetic resonance imaging, scanned used to diagnose illness and injury.
1998 - The first adult live-donor liver transplant is carried out
